![]() |
Здравствуйте, гость ( Вход | Регистрация )
![]() |
![]()
Сообщение
#1
|
|
Частый гость ![]() ![]() ![]() Группа: Участники Сообщений: 58 Регистрация: 19.1.2010 Из: Санкт-Петербург Пользователь №: 14216 ![]() |
Доброго дня.
Некоторое время назад настраивал связку: пров1<-->(аналоговые CO)<-->LDK100<-->(PRI)<-->asterisk<-->(PRI)<------пров2 К LDK100 подключено энное количество внутренних телефонов (нумерация 1XX), к * - энное количество SIP-клиентов 2XX, 3XX. (Предыстория) PRI между LDK и asterisk занимает со стороны LDK 16 CO (24-40), из них 4 (24-28) - Networking CO line type=NET и используются для выдачи звонков на SIP-абонентов * с номерами 2XX-3XX, остальные 12 (29-40) - PSTN и используются для выдачи звонков провайдеру. Все работает как надо, за одним исключением: если приходит звонок от "пров2" через астериск на абонента LDK, скажем 120, и он решает перевести звонок на SIP-абонента *, скажем 240, то после того, как абонент 120 нажимает третью цифру, на 240 раздается звонок, а в город немедленно уходит отбой. При этом "внутренние" звонки - с EXT LDK на SIP-клиентов asterisk - проходят нормально, и входящие по аналоговым линиям от "пров1" в LDK звонки тоже переводятся на SIP-клиентов без вопросов. Пошарился по форуму, нашел вот это обсуждение. Попробовал сделать Net transfer mode = JOIN вместо REROUT, попробовал CO24-28 перевести из типа NET в тип PSTN - толку ноль. Железо: MPBN Version: GS90P-3.7Bd MAR/07, в консоли: 0 MPBN 3.7Bd 5 PRIB 3.0G 30 лицензии Q.SIG нету. Как думаете, что и где можно покрутить? |
|
|
![]() |
![]()
Сообщение
#2
|
|
![]() Ветеран форума ![]() ![]() ![]() ![]() ![]() Группа: Участники Сообщений: 1508 Регистрация: 13.10.2006 Из: Каменск-Уральский Пользователь №: 42 ![]() |
Попробуйте (на 100-ке) убрать музыку на удержании, на тон удержания. * (не все)к нему (МОН) "неравнодушны". Могут разорвать соединение, могут сделать одностороннее.
Цитата а в город немедленно уходит отбой. А кто инициатор-то? Снимайте сценарий.
|
|
|
![]()
Сообщение
#3
|
|
Частый гость ![]() ![]() ![]() Группа: Участники Сообщений: 58 Регистрация: 19.1.2010 Из: Санкт-Петербург Пользователь №: 14216 ![]() |
Re. МЕня тут уезжало...
Попробуйте (на 100-ке) убрать музыку на удержании, на тон удержания. * (не все)к нему (МОН) "неравнодушны". Могут разорвать соединение, могут сделать одностороннее. А кто инициатор-то? Снимайте сценарий. На музыку пофиг, но на всякий случай попробовал сменить на тон - легче не стало. Снял трассу PRI звонка с asterisk, как снять трассу с LDK - порылся по форуму, но пока не нашел --- # входящий звонок от оператора на asterisk на номер 6073920 < TEI=0 Call Ref: len= 2 (reference 88/0x58) (Sent from originator) < Message Type: SETUP (5) <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Preferred Dchan: 0 < Ext: 1 Coding: 0 Number Specified Channel Type: 3 < Ext: 1 Channel: 7 Type: CPE] < Calling Number (len=14) [ Ext: 0 TON: National Number (2)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1) < Presentation: Presentation permitted, user number passed network screening (1) '8123291270' ] < Called Number (len=10) [ Ext: 1 TON: National Number (2)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1) '6073920' ] > TEI=0 Call Ref: len= 2 (reference 88/0x58) (Sent to originator) > Message Type: CALL PROCEEDING (2) >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Exclusive Dchan: 0 > Ext: 1 Coding: 0 Number Specified Channel Type: 3 > Ext: 1 Channel: 7 Type: CPE] # исх. звонок с asterisk на ldk100 на абонента 118 > TEI=0 Call Ref: len= 2 (reference 4854/0x12F6) (Sent from originator) > Message Type: SETUP (5) >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Exclusive Dchan: 0 > Ext: 1 Coding: 0 Number Specified Channel Type: 3 > Ext: 1 Channel: 1 Type: NET] > Calling Number (len=14) [ Ext: 0 TON: National Number (2)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1) > Presentation: Presentation permitted, user number passed network screening (1) '8123291270' ] > Called Number (len= 6) [ Ext: 1 TON: National Number (2)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1) '118' ] < TEI=0 Call Ref: len= 2 (reference 4854/0x12F6) (Sent to originator) < Message Type: CALL PROCEEDING (2) <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Exclusive Dchan: 0 < Ext: 1 Coding: 0 Number Specified Channel Type: 3 < Ext: 1 Channel: 1 Type: NET] # гудки от ldk100 asterisk'у по входящему на 118 < TEI=0 Call Ref: len= 2 (reference 4854/0x12F6) (Sent to originator) < Message Type: ALERTING (1) <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Exclusive Dchan: 0 < Ext: 1 Coding: 0 Number Specified Channel Type: 3 < Ext: 1 Channel: 1 Type: NET] # гудки от asterisk'а в город > TEI=0 Call Ref: len= 2 (reference 88/0x58) (Sent to originator) > Message Type: ALERTING (1) > Progress Indicator (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) 0: 0 Location: Private network serving the local user (1) > Ext: 1 Progress Description: Inband information or appropriate pattern now available. (8) ] [skip - ждем снятия трубки на 118] # от ldk100 asteriskу: абонент 118 взял трубу < TEI=0 Call Ref: len= 2 (reference 4854/0x12F6) (Sent to originator) < Message Type: CONNECT (7) < Connected Number (len= 7) [ Ext: 0 TON: Unknown Number Type (0)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1) < Ext: 1 Presentation: Presentation permitted, user number passed network screening (1) '118' ] > TEI=0 Call Ref: len= 2 (reference 4854/0x12F6) (Sent from originator) > Message Type: CONNECT ACKNOWLEDGE (15) # от asterisk в город: звонок отвечен > TEI=0 Call Ref: len= 2 (reference 88/0x58) (Sent to originator) > Message Type: CONNECT (7) >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Exclusive Dchan: 0 > Ext: 1 Coding: 0 Number Specified Channel Type: 3 > Ext: 1 Channel: 7 Type: CPE] > Progress Indicator (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) 0: 0 Location: Private network serving the local user (1) > Ext: 1 Progress Description: Called equipment is non-ISDN. (2) ] > Connected Number (len= 7) [ Ext: 0 TON: Unknown Number Type (0)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1) > Ext: 1 Presentation: Presentation permitted, user number passed network screening (1) '118' ] < TEI=0 Call Ref: len= 2 (reference 88/0x58) (Sent from originator) < Message Type: CONNECT ACKNOWLEDGE (15) # тут на внутреннем абоненте 118 ldk100 нажимается flash, набирается номер 240 и... # от ldk100 asteriskу приходит disconnect < TEI=0 Call Ref: len= 2 (reference 4854/0x12F6) (Sent to originator) < Message Type: DISCONNECT (69) <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: User (0) < Ext: 1 Cause: Normal Clearing (16), class = Normal Event (1) ] > TEI=0 Call Ref: len= 2 (reference 4854/0x12F6) (Sent from originator) > Message Type: RELEASE (77) >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: Private network serving the local user (1) > Ext: 1 Cause: Normal Clearing (16), class = Normal Event (1) ] # asterisk посылает DISCONNECT в город вызывающему. > TEI=0 Call Ref: len= 2 (reference 88/0x58) (Sent to originator) > Message Type: DISCONNECT (69) >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: Private network serving the local user (1) > Ext: 1 Cause: Normal Clearing (16), class = Normal Event (1) ] < TEI=0 Call Ref: len= 2 (reference 88/0x58) (Sent from originator) < Message Type: RELEASE (77) > Protocol Discriminator: Q.931 (8) len=9 > TEI=0 Call Ref: len= 2 (reference 88/0x58) (Sent to originator) > Message Type: RELEASE COMPLETE (90) >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: Private network serving the local user (1) > Ext: 1 Cause: Normal Clearing (16), class = Normal Event (1) ] # тем временем ldk100 посылает на asterisk вызов для сетевого абонента 240 < TEI=0 Call Ref: len= 2 (reference 32514/0x7F02) (Sent from originator) < Message Type: SETUP (5) <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Exclusive Dchan: 0 < Ext: 1 Coding: 0 Number Specified Channel Type: 3 < Ext: 1 Channel: 2 Type: NET] < Calling Number (len= 7) [ Ext: 0 TON: Unknown Number Type (0) NPI: ISDN/Telephony Numbering Plan (E.164/E.163) (1) < Presentation: Presentation permitted, user number passed network screening (1) '118' ] < Called Number (len= 6) [ Ext: 1 TON: Unknown Number Type (0) NPI: Unknown Number Plan (0) '240' ] > TEI=0 Call Ref: len= 2 (reference 32514/0x7F02) (Sent to originator) > Message Type: CALL PROCEEDING (2) > Channel ID (len= 5) [ Ext: 1 IntID: Implicit Other(PRI) Spare: 0 Exclusive Dchan: 0 > ChanSel: As indicated in following octets > Ext: 1 Coding: 0 Number Specified Channel Type: 3 > Ext: 1 Channel: 2 Type: NET] # release complete от ldk100 на asterisk по звонку на 118 < TEI=0 Call Ref: len= 2 (reference 4854/0x12F6) (Sent to originator) < Message Type: RELEASE COMPLETE (90) <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: Private network serving the local user (1) < Ext: 1 Cause: Normal Clearing (16), class = Normal Event (1) ] # тем временем asterisk вызвал абонента 240, о чем и извещает ldk100 > TEI=0 Call Ref: len= 2 (reference 32514/0x7F02) (Sent to originator) > Message Type: ALERTING (1) > Progress Indicator (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) 0: 0 Location: Private network serving the local user (1) > Ext: 1 Progress Description: Inband information or appropriate pattern now available. (8) ] [skip] # абонент 240 положил трубку < TEI=0 Call Ref: len= 2 (reference 32514/0x7F02) (Sent from originator) < Message Type: DISCONNECT (69) <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: User (0) < Ext: 1 Cause: Normal Clearing (16), class = Normal Event (1) ] > TEI=0 Call Ref: len= 2 (reference 32514/0x7F02) (Sent to originator) > Message Type: RELEASE (77) >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: Private network serving the local user (1) > Ext: 1 Cause: Normal Clearing (16), class = Normal Event (1) ] < TEI=0 Call Ref: len= 2 (reference 32514/0x7F02) (Sent from originator) < Message Type: RELEASE COMPLETE (90) < Cause (len= 4) [ Ext: 1 Coding: CCITT (ITU) standard (0) Spare: 0 Location: Private network serving the local user (1) < Ext: 1 Cause: Normal Clearing (16), class = Normal Event (1) ] # всё |
|
|
![]() ![]() |
Текстовая версия | Сейчас: 17.7.2025, 0:40 |